Popular science, nature & technology magazines[edit]

See the main article on this topic: Popular science

The below publications feature news, comment and analysis about scientific knowledge in a way meant to be more accessible to the general public. Contents may have been written by scientists, non-scientists who are otherwise experts of some kind, science-focused journalists, or possibly guest writers.

Peer reviewed journals[edit]

See the main article on this topic: Peer review

The journals below feature original research, as well as news, comment and analysis of this research, which has been reviewed by fellow scientists.
